Notes

A sixteen-node Cerebras inference cluster, provisioned as ten cabinets: eight WSE cabinets holding two CS-3 systems each, plus two NET cabinets. Provisioned heat load is approximately 475 kW, about 440 kW on water and 35 kW on air. That is Cerebras's own provisioned total including networking, not sixteen times the 27 kW system figure. The cluster holds 704 GB of on-chip SRAM and no DRAM. Each engine is rated at 125 petaFLOPS, footnoted by Cerebras as sparse; the sparsity is unstructured, so no dense figure is derived.
